George G. Raveaux
RAVEAUX, George G., 81, of Weirton, a loving husband and father who never met a stranger, passed away Thursday, Nov, 12, 2009, in the Weirton Geriatric Center.
Born Oct, 14, 1928, in Weirton, he was the son of the late George and Catherine Nusser Raveaux.
With 38 years of service, Mr. Raveaux retired from Weirton Steel where he worked as an engineer in the transportation department.
A member of the Weir High Class of 1946, he was a member of the Weirton Heights Memorial Baptist Church and WSX 25-Year Club. He served as Past Exalted Ruler and secretary of the Elks Lodge 1801.
George was a former coach for the Weirton Termite baseball league. He enjoyed gardening and riding his motorcycle. While not making his homemade wine, Mr. Raveaux also enjoyed cooking and baking.
